什么是全量NPV加速器?它的主要功能和优势有哪些?
全量NPV加速器是一种提升大数据处理效率的专业硬件设备,主要用于优化企业级存储和计算性能。它通过硬件加速技术显著缩短数据处理时间,提升系统整体性能。全量NPV(Network Processing Unit)加速器的核心目标是解决传统存储和网络设备在面对海量数据时的瓶颈问题,使企业能够更快速、更高效地完成数据分析和处理任务。
全量NPV加速器的主要功能集中在数据传输优化、网络处理能力提升以及存储系统的整合方面。它采用先进的FPGA(现场可编程门阵列)或ASIC(专用集成电路)芯片,能够在硬件层面实现高速数据包处理与过滤。这样一来,数据在传输过程中不会成为系统的瓶颈,确保大规模数据的实时处理能力。此外,它还能智能管理多路径传输,减少数据丢失和延迟,为大数据环境提供稳定保障。
从优势角度考虑,全量NPV加速器带来了多方面的提升。首先,数据处理速度大幅提升,据行业报告显示,使用NPV加速器可以使数据传输效率提高3到5倍。其次,系统稳定性增强,硬件加速降低了软件层面的负担,减少了故障率。再次,能耗降低,硬件优化设计使得在高性能运行的同时,能耗也得以控制。最后,扩展性强,支持多种网络协议和存储架构,方便企业根据需要进行系统升级和扩展。
全量NPV加速器的安装流程是怎样的?需要准备哪些工具和环境?
全量NPV加速器的安装流程关键在于环境准备与硬件配置,确保系统兼容性和性能优化。在开始安装之前,您需要明确硬件环境、软件依赖以及网络配置等多个方面的准备工作。这样可以避免在安装过程中出现不必要的错误,确保加速器能够稳定高效运行。
首先,确认您的服务器硬件是否符合全量NPV加速器的最低配置要求。根据官方文档(如来自华为云或阿里云的技术资料),建议配备多核CPU、大容量内存以及高速存储设备,以满足大数据处理的需求。同时,确保硬件设备连接稳定,电源供应充足,避免运行过程中出现中断或故障。
在软件环境方面,建议提前安装支持的操作系统版本,例如Ubuntu 20.04或CentOS 8,这些版本经过验证兼容性较好。还需准备相应的依赖软件包,如Python、Docker(如果采用容器部署)以及相关的网络工具。确保所有软件版本符合官方推荐,避免版本冲突带来的兼容性问题。可以参考官方安装指南(例如华为云的技术文档)获取详细的环境配置建议。
网络环境的配置也尤为重要。建议设置专用的高速局域网,确保全量NPV加速器与数据源之间的连接稳定且低延迟。必要时,可以调整网络参数,开启QoS策略,优先保障数据传输通畅。此外,确保服务器的防火墙策略允许相关端口的通信,避免网络阻塞影响加速器的性能发挥。详细的网络配置步骤可以参考相关网络安全指南,确保环境安全且高效。
准备工作完成后,您可以按照官方提供的安装步骤逐步进行。一般包括下载安装包、解压部署、配置环境变量及启动服务等环节。建议在安装前备份重要配置文件与数据,以便出现问题时快速恢复。整个流程中,建议保持文档记录,确保每一步都按照标准操作,减少误操作导致的故障。若遇到具体问题,可参考官方社区或技术支持资源,获取及时帮助与解决方案。
如何配置全量NPV加速器以实现最佳性能?有哪些关键参数需要设置?
合理配置全量NPV加速器的关键参数,能显著提升其性能表现和系统稳定性。在实际操作中,您需要根据具体的使用场景和硬件环境,调整多项参数以达到最佳效果。首先,确保对加速器的硬件资源进行充分了解,包括GPU、内存和存储容量,这为后续参数配置提供基础依据。
在配置过程中,最核心的参数之一是调度策略。建议采用动态调度模式,能够根据任务负载自动调整资源分配,从而避免资源浪费或瓶颈问题。具体操作上,可以在配置文件中设定优先级、任务队列长度和调度算法(如轮询或加权调度),以优化整体性能表现。
此外,数据传输参数的合理设置同样至关重要。建议调整批处理大小(batch size)以平衡处理速度和内存使用。过大的批处理会导致内存溢出,而过小则会降低吞吐率。根据官方文档(如NVIDIA的CUDA调优指南),通常建议批处理大小为硬件最大承载能力的80%左右,确保性能最大化。
网络通信参数也不容忽视。对网络带宽和延迟进行优化,可以通过设置合理的超时参数和缓冲区大小,减少数据传输的等待时间,提升整体效率。建议利用专用高速网络(如InfiniBand),并配置相关参数以降低延迟,确保数据在各节点间快速流动。
在实际操作中,建议逐步调优参数,每次调整后进行性能测试,记录变化效果。可以采用性能监控工具(如NVIDIA Nsight或Prometheus),实时观察GPU利用率、内存占用和网络传输状态,以便科学调整参数。通过不断试验,找到最适合自己系统的参数组合,从而实现全量NPV加速器的最佳性能。
在安装和配置过程中常见的问题及解决方案有哪些?
在安装和配置全量NPV加速器时,常见问题主要集中在兼容性、性能调优以及环境配置方面。 这些问题若未妥善解决,可能导致加速器无法正常运行或达不到预期的加速效果。理解并掌握常见问题及其解决方案,有助于确保全量NPV加速器的顺利部署和高效运行。
一个常见的问题是硬件与软件的不兼容。全量NPV加速器依赖特定的硬件环境,比如GPU或FPGA芯片,如果硬件型号或驱动版本不符合要求,可能导致驱动无法正常加载或加速器无法识别设备。解决方案是仔细核查官方文档中的硬件兼容列表,确保使用的硬件型号在支持范围内。同时,及时更新驱动程序和固件版本,避免因版本过旧引发兼容性问题。建议在安装前,参考厂商提供的硬件配置指南,以确保环境的基础条件满足要求。
性能调优方面,许多用户在配置过程中遇到瓶颈,尤其是在多任务或大数据环境下。常见原因包括内存不足、网络带宽限制或配置参数不合理。为此,建议逐步调整参数,例如调整批处理大小、优化内存分配策略,以及合理配置网络传输参数。可以利用官方提供的性能测试工具进行压力测试,识别潜在的性能瓶颈。此外,关注行业领先的性能优化指南,如NVIDIA或Intel的优化建议,可以帮助你更科学地进行调优。
环境配置错误也是导致问题的一个重要因素。环境变量设置不当、依赖库版本不匹配、缺少必要的依赖组件等,都可能影响全量NPV加速器的正常运行。建议在安装前,详细阅读官方安装手册,严格按照步骤配置环境变量。使用容器化技术(如Docker)可以有效隔离环境,减少配置错误的风险。确保所有依赖项均符合版本要求,并在安装后进行全面测试,验证配置是否正确。此外,定期关注官方社区和技术支持渠道,获取最新的环境配置指南和补丁信息,有助于及时解决潜在问题。
总结来看,要避免安装和配置中的常见问题,建议制定详细的操作流程,逐步验证每个环节的正确性。遇到问题时,保持冷静,逐项排查,从硬件兼容到环境配置,逐步缩小问题范围。借助专业的技术支持和官方文档,确保每一步都符合规范,是实现全量NPV加速器高效部署的关键所在。通过系统学习和持续优化,你将能够充分发挥全量NPV加速器的强大性能,为企业带来显著的效率提升。
如何进行全量NPV加速器的性能优化和维护?有哪些最佳实践?
全量NPV加速器的性能优化和维护关键在于持续监控、合理配置和定期升级。这些措施能确保加速器在复杂环境中保持高效稳定的运行表现。为了实现最佳性能,您需要结合实际应用场景,采取科学的优化策略和维护方案。
首先,建立全面的性能监控体系非常重要。通过配置专业的监控工具,例如Prometheus或Grafana,可以实时跟踪全量NPV加速器的关键指标,如处理速度、延迟、资源利用率和错误率。监控数据不仅帮助您发现潜在瓶颈,还能指导后续的优化措施。此外,定期分析性能趋势,识别异常波动,及时采取相应措施,确保系统持续平稳运行。根据行业权威报告,持续监控已成为企业保障加速器高效运行的核心手段(如《2023年云原生基础设施报告》)。
在配置方面,合理调优参数是提升性能的关键。应根据实际负载情况,调整缓存策略、线程数和内存分配。例如,增加缓存容量可以减少磁盘I/O,提高响应速度。合理设置线程池大小,避免资源争用和死锁,确保多任务并发处理的效率。建议参考官方文档或专业技术社区,结合具体硬件环境进行参数调优,避免盲目追求最大化配置带来的资源浪费。此外,利用自动调优工具,如Kubernetes中的自动扩展策略,也有助于动态适应不同负载变化。
定期升级和补丁管理是保持全量NPV加速器性能的基础。随着技术的发展和安全漏洞的不断曝光,及时应用最新版本的固件和软件补丁,能有效提升系统稳定性和安全性。建议您关注厂商发布的安全公告和更新通知,并制定详细的升级计划,确保在非高峰时段完成升级,减少对业务的影响。根据行业专家的建议,自动化部署和版本控制工具可以显著简化维护流程,提高升级效率(参见《企业IT维护最佳实践》)。
此外,建立完善的故障排查和应急预案也非常必要。通过日志分析、故障模拟和应急演练,提升团队的响应能力。当出现性能瓶颈或故障时,能够快速定位问题源头,采取有效措施,减少系统停机时间。建议结合行业最佳实践,建立详细的故障处理流程,并定期进行演练,以确保团队熟悉操作流程,提升整体维护水平(参考《企业信息安全管理体系标准》ISO/IEC 27001)。
常见问题解答
全量NPV加速器的主要功能是什么?
全量NPV加速器主要用于提升大数据处理效率,优化存储和网络性能,缩短数据传输和处理时间。
安装全量NPV加速器需要准备哪些环境?
需要确认硬件符合要求,准备支持的操作系统和依赖软件,以及配置高速稳定的网络环境。
如何配置全量NPV加速器以获得最佳性能?
应根据硬件环境调整关键参数,如网络设置、传输策略和硬件资源分配,以确保系统稳定高效运行。